  • Oakmont Farmers Market

    Oakmont Farmers Market


    September 6, 2023

    Oakmont Famers Market

    The Oakmont Farmers Market, located in the Oakmont section of Havertown, Pennsylvania, is a producers-only market featuring locally farmed vegetables, fruit, cheese, eggs and poultry, beef, lamb, wine, beer and other products. It is located in the Grace Chapel Parking Lot at 1 West Eagle Road in Havertown, on the southeast corner of the Darby and Eagle Roads intersection.  Rain or shine, come out and Buy Fresh, Buy Local!”

    Clark Park Farmers Market

    Clark Park Farmers Market


    September 9, 2023

    Established in West Philly in 1998, this market is one of The Food Trust's largest with a wide variety of fruits, vegetables, baked and canned goods, meats and specialty products. Clark Park Saturday market is a neighborhood favorite that operates year-round thanks to support from Philadelphia Parks and Recreation, Friends of Clark Park and the University of the Sciences.

  • Headhouse Famers Market

    Headhouse Famers Market


    September 10, 2023

    Established in 2007, this market is located in the historic Society Hill neighborhood of Philadelphia. Featuring nearly 50 rotating vendors, Headhouse is one of The Food Trust's largest farmers markets. Beyond the abundance of fresh produce, you can also find a great selection of locally prepared foods and artisanal goods such as soups, caneles, ice cream, coffee and wine.

    Headhouse Farmers Market is operating on winter hours of 10 a.m.-1 p.m., January through April.
